Transaction d5ff66e16f71abe13bb5526c0aeeabf9acb8607e13400d98f40d31f91dcc4d77
1 Input
1 Output
-
d5ff66e16f71abe13bb5526c0aeeabf9acb8607e13400d98f40d31f91dcc4d77:0
- value
- 323334
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 09420d10de469fc89df83b0544c83b5b46ff2c68 OP_EQUAL
- address
- 32Xy8aQmfNoHRBdUJ3GfAmwoLefbv9uQt4